USB Type-C for fewer cable headaches
A couple years after the advent of Apple's Lightning cable, the USB Implementers Forum is readying its response.USB 3.1 will be faster than its predecessor. But more importantly, it'll use reversible USB-Type-C connectors, so you won't have to think about whether you're inserting a cable right-side up.
We'll likely suffer through a dark period of adapters, special USB 3.0-to-3.1 cables, and legacy connectors sitting side-by-side with their successors, but it'll be worth the transition to a standard cable with fewer headaches.
